What is a securities expert witness?
Securities expert witness candidates have areas of expertise in securities law, securities regulation, economic damage calculations, financial planning, forensic accounting, financial markets, and/or are certified fraud examiners (CFE) or registered investment advisors. Securities litigation expert witnesses are attorneys with experience in securities and regulatory investigations. An experienced securities fraud expert witness may be needed if financial crimes are suspected. While many experts have expertise in securities matters, an expert witness carries the additional responsibility of providing testimony in a manner whereby lay people can understand the litigation matters and evidence.

Securities are tradable financial assets, and can be categorized into three main types:
- Debt securities (for example – banknotes, bonds and debentures)
- Equity securities (for example – common stocks)
- Derivatives (for example – forwards, futures, options, and swaps)

What litigation support work might a securities expert witness be expected to perform?
Litigation support services by a securities expert witness could represent either the plaintiff or defendant, and work could include case reviews, FINRA arbitrations, research and authoring expert reports, providing expert opinions, expert testimony, and/or courtroom testimony. In a high-profile case, or litigation involving a significant financial stake, a law firm may request an expert with prior expert witness testimony experience. In addition, clients may seek a securities industry expert or financial advisor for pre-litigation consulting services.
